We report the following classifications of optical transients from spectroscopic observations with the Kast spectrograph on the Shane telescope. Targets were supplied by ZTF and YSE. All observations were made on 2019 Feb 2 UT. Classifications were performed with SNID (Blondin & Tonry, 2007, ApJ, 666, 1024).

 
Name         | IAU Name  | RA (J2000)  | Dec (J2000)  |   z   | Type  |  Phase | Notes
ZTF20aahzyml | AT2020atv | 10:05:05.98 | -12:07:35.73 | 0.08 | Ia | +3 d | (1) ZTF20aaiftgi | AT2020aut | 14:10:13.38 | -06:49:20.71 | 0.033 | Ic | +5 d | PS20jn | AT2020azs | 09:33:45.59 | +33:01:41.25 | 0.135 | Ia | -5 d | (2) ZTF20aajcdad | AT2020bcq | 13:26:29.65 | +36:00:31.16 | 0.018 | Ib | -4 d |

Notes: When the redshift is given to 2 decimal places, it is derived from the SN spectrum. Otherwise, the redshift is determined from the host galaxy. (1) We measure an Si II 6355 velocity of -10,500 km/s. (2) We measure an Si II 6355 velocity of -11,700 km/s.
